隨著現(xiàn)代企業(yè)對(duì)數(shù)字化轉(zhuǎn)型的需求愈發(fā)迫切以及其對(duì)于軟件交付的效率和穩(wěn)定性要求越來越高,開發(fā)團(tuán)隊(duì)面臨的技術(shù)挑戰(zhàn)愈發(fā)嚴(yán)峻。那么具體而言,如何通過持續(xù)交付來提升軟件開發(fā)的效率呢?一起看看下文關(guān)于持續(xù)交付的介紹吧。
持續(xù)交付是一種軟件開發(fā)流程的理念和策略,旨在提高軟件開發(fā)的效率和質(zhì)量。持續(xù)交付通過集成開發(fā)工具和流程,使得軟件開發(fā)過程中的每個(gè)環(huán)節(jié)都能緊密相連,從而確保代碼的快速、穩(wěn)定、持續(xù)地交付到生產(chǎn)環(huán)境。極狐GitLab是一個(gè)集代碼托管、CI/CD、問題追蹤等多項(xiàng)功能于一體的開發(fā)平臺(tái),其為企業(yè)提供了實(shí)現(xiàn)持續(xù)交付的完整解決方案:
1.代碼托管與協(xié)作:極狐GitLab支持Git代碼托管,提供多人協(xié)作開發(fā)的平臺(tái),使團(tuán)隊(duì)成員可以更高效地管理和跟蹤代碼變更。
2.自動(dòng)化測試與集成:通過集成自動(dòng)化測試工具,極狐GitLab可以在代碼提交后自動(dòng)進(jìn)行代碼質(zhì)量檢測和單元測試,確保代碼的質(zhì)量和穩(wěn)定性。
3.快速部署與迭代:借助極狐GitLab的CI/CD功能,開發(fā)者可以輕松實(shí)現(xiàn)代碼的自動(dòng)構(gòu)建、部署和發(fā)布,大大縮短了開發(fā)周期。
4.實(shí)時(shí)反饋與監(jiān)控:通過極狐GitLab的問題追蹤系統(tǒng),團(tuán)隊(duì)可以實(shí)時(shí)獲取用戶反饋和問題報(bào)告,及時(shí)修復(fù)和改進(jìn)產(chǎn)品。同時(shí),平臺(tái)還提供了豐富的監(jiān)控工具,幫助團(tuán)隊(duì)了解產(chǎn)品的運(yùn)行狀態(tài)和性能。
持續(xù)交付是現(xiàn)代軟件開發(fā)的重要趨勢,極狐GitLab作為一款強(qiáng)大的開發(fā)工具,能夠提高軟件開發(fā)的效率,降低開發(fā)和運(yùn)維的成本,極大地提升用戶體驗(yàn)。對(duì)于想更高效地管理軟件開發(fā)過程,提升整體競爭實(shí)力的企業(yè)而言,極狐GitLab值得信賴。